contrib/fuzz/Makefile
changeset 43862 b7af8a02a304
parent 43861 d74d78aa74e9
child 44997 ef8dcee272ac
equal deleted inserted replaced
43861:d74d78aa74e9 43862:b7af8a02a304
    60 	$(CC) -I../../mercurial `$(PYTHON_CONFIG) --cflags` $(CFLAGS) -c \
    60 	$(CC) -I../../mercurial `$(PYTHON_CONFIG) --cflags` $(CFLAGS) -c \
    61 	  -o $@ $<
    61 	  -o $@ $<
    62 
    62 
    63 PARSERS_OBJS=parsers-manifest.o parsers-charencode.o parsers-parsers.o parsers-dirs.o parsers-pathencode.o parsers-revlog.o
    63 PARSERS_OBJS=parsers-manifest.o parsers-charencode.o parsers-parsers.o parsers-dirs.o parsers-pathencode.o parsers-revlog.o
    64 
    64 
    65 dirs_fuzzer: dirs.cc pyutil.o $(PARSERS_OBJS)
    65 dirs_fuzzer: dirs.cc pyutil.o $(PARSERS_OBJS) $$OUT/dirs_fuzzer_seed_corpus.zip
    66 	$(CXX) $(CXXFLAGS) `$(PYTHON_CONFIG) --cflags` \
    66 	$(CXX) $(CXXFLAGS) `$(PYTHON_CONFIG) --cflags` \
    67 	  -Wno-register -Wno-macro-redefined \
    67 	  -Wno-register -Wno-macro-redefined \
    68 	  -I../../mercurial dirs.cc \
    68 	  -I../../mercurial dirs.cc \
    69 	  pyutil.o $(PARSERS_OBJS) \
    69 	  pyutil.o $(PARSERS_OBJS) \
    70 	  $(LIB_FUZZING_ENGINE) `$(PYTHON_CONFIG) --ldflags` \
    70 	  $(LIB_FUZZING_ENGINE) `$(PYTHON_CONFIG) --ldflags` \